UMass Partnership Funds Get 10-to-1 Return

Companies associated with the Massachusetts Medical Device Development Center, including Wayland-based MedicaMetrix, have raised more than $5 million in private funding so far.

M2D2, a partnership between UMass Lowell and the University of Massachusetts Medical School in Worcester, said the medical device companies received a total of $500,000 in M2D2 FastLane awards and used that startup funding to attract the private capital.

MedicaMetrix is developing the ProstaGlove, a urological medical device for measuring prostate volume.

The other companies receiving the funding were MoMelan of Cambridge, TheraTorr of Beverly and Aura Medsystems of Duxbury.
